Social Impact Senior Evaluation Advisor, Monitoring and Evaluation Support Job Vacancy in Rwanda

Background:
Social Impact (SI) is a Washington,
DC-area international development management consulting firm. We provide a full
range of innovative program evaluation, management consulting, technical
assistance, and training services to strengthen international development
programs, organizations and policies. Our global services are in the areas of
democracy and governance, health and education, agriculture, the environment,
and economic growth.

Objective:
USAID is planning a new five-year
M&E project in Rwanda to support the USAID mission with integrated M&E
services for its entire project portfolio. The project is an essential M&E
Office for USAID and will serve as an extension of the USAID mission. The
proposed opportunity provides USAID/Rwanda with technical and advisory services
for evaluation activities at the mission (operating unit) level. This may
include designing and implementing both quantitative and qualitative evaluation
studies and assessments as well as providing evaluation technical assistance
for USAID/Rwanda development programs. These efforts will facilitate informed
program management decisions, shape the longer-term strategic direction of
programs and decision-making within the Mission, and enable USAID/Rwanda to
comply with USAID’s Evaluation Policy. SI is seeking a Senior Evaluation
Advisor for a full-time position on this contract.
Responsibilities and Tasks:
The Evaluation Advisor shall be
responsible for leading the design and implementation activities including
Evaluation and Assessments. S/he will work with the Contracting Officer’s
Representative and other USAID technical staff to develop the methodologies
necessary to meet the deliverables required in the SOWs for evaluation tasks.
The Evaluation Advisor will be the lead analyst for interpreting the results of
surveys and other field data and be responsible for report preparation.
Qualifications:
  • A
    Master’s Degree (or foreign equivalent) in relevant field;
  • Minimum
    eight (8) years of progressive experience

    in designing, implementing, managing, and analyzing the results of
    both performance and impact evaluations of development projects.
    Preferably, at least five (5) of these years should be in developing
    countries
    and at least three (3) of these years implementing
    international donors-funded projects;
  • At
    least five (5) years of experience implementing quantitative and
    qualitative
    data collection and analysis for evaluations and
    assessments
    , including experience with sampling methods, database
    management and statistical analysis;
  • At
    least three (3) years of experience leading evaluation
    teams, or research teams;
  • Fluency
    in spoken and written English is required; and
  • Excellent
    team management and interpersonal skills.
